set version to 8:0:0
[heimdal.git] / cf / check-var.m4
blob96b9e484f682ea193a056453335b9cff7657b93a
1 dnl $Id$
2 dnl
3 dnl AC_CHECK_VAR(includes, variable)
4 AC_DEFUN(AC_CHECK_VAR, [
5 AC_MSG_CHECKING(for $2)
6 AC_CACHE_VAL(ac_cv_var_$2, [
7 AC_TRY_LINK([extern int $2;
8 int foo() { return $2; }],
9             [foo()],
10             ac_cv_var_$2=yes, ac_cv_var_$2=no)
12 define([foo], [HAVE_]translit($2, [a-z], [A-Z]))
14 AC_MSG_RESULT(`eval echo \\$ac_cv_var_$2`)
15 if test `eval echo \\$ac_cv_var_$2` = yes; then
16         AC_DEFINE_UNQUOTED(foo, 1, [define if you have $2])
17         AC_CHECK_DECLARATION([$1],[$2])
19 undefine([foo])